Andriy Shevchenko Poses Huge Threat

Dynamo Kyiv Captain Andriy Shevchenko might be coming to the end of his illustrious career, however, the 34-year-old Ukrainian still poses a threat in front of goal.

Shevchenko's three year stint at Chelsea didn't go according to what owner Roman Abramovich would have hoped, but then again we could say that about Robinho and look what he's currently achieving at AC Milan.

Andriy's final swansong before he hangs up his playing boots for good is to try and achieve success with Dynamo Kyiv. He has won a hatful of major honours, none other than being voted the Champions League Best Forward in 1999. I am sure he will try and end his career on a high and the only way he can do that is by winning this years Europa League. But we can't allow that can we?

City's defence on Thursday is going to in for a torrid time but with a bit of luck we'll do whatever it takes to progress in the competition. After all I hear Dublin is a lovely place to visit in May.
